Wonder Woman #23.1 – Cheetah #1

In the forests of Louisiana, something stirs. It’s Barbara Minerva, the Cheetah, and having been freed from Belle Reve prison by the Crime Syndicate of Earth 3, she’s on the run. And running is something the Cheetah does very well, with speed levels to challenge the Flash. As great as her speed is her ferocity, […]

Read More Wonder Woman #23.1 – Cheetah #1